Niobium and tantalum - USGS

Niobium and tantalum are transition metals that are almost always found together in nature because they have very similar physical and chemical properties. Their properties of hardness, conductivity, and resistance to corrosion largely determine their primary uses today. The leading use of niobium (about 75 percent) is in the production of high-strength steel alloys used in pipelines ...


Processing of ores to produce tantalum and lithium ...

Tantalum occurs as complex pentoxide minerals in association with niobium and tin. It is recovered by gravity separation followed by pyrometallurgical processes, and then solvent extraction to produce Ta 2 O 5 as the starting material for carbide production, or K 2 TaF 7 as the starting material for the production of tantalum metal for super ...


Tantalum Processing | TIC - Tantalum-Niobium International ...

Generally, the tantalum values in solution are converted into potassium tantalum fluoride (K 2 TaF 7) or tantalum oxide (Ta 2 O 5). The niobium is recovered as niobium oxide (Nb 2 O 5 ) via neutralization of the niobium fluoride complex with ammonia to form the hydroxide, followed by calcination to the oxide.

Liquid–liquid extraction of tantalum and niobium by ...

Extraction of tantalum and niobium from sulfate leach liquor of south Gabal El-A'urf polymineralized ore material was carried out by using octanol. The latter was contacted with the sulfate leach liquor prepared after fusing the highly mineralized ore sample with potassium bisulphate in a weight ratio of 1/3 at 650 °C for 3 h.

Tantalum, niobium and lithium - Earth Resources

Tantalum and niobium are always found together, usually in minerals of the tantalite–columbite series in pegmatites, granites, carbonatites and alkaline igneous rocks. Tantalum and niobium are associated with tin-bearing aplite–pegmatite–greisen dykes in northeastern Victoria. The Walwa tinfield, including the Mount Alwa and Bounce mines ...

ORE PREPARATION AND CBMM - niobium.tech

Niobium occurs in the mineral pandaite, which is essentially a complex oxide hydro-oxide of niobium, barium, titanium, rare earths of the cerium group, and thorium. The ore is radioactive due to presence of thorium (0.12% in the ore) in the pandaite and monazite minerals. Table I1 shows a complete chemical analysis of a representative ore sample.
